The Great British Bake Off (Channel 4, 8pm) 

For the very first time on the baking competition, we’re being treated to a vegan week. Bakers have to make a savoury pastry Signature, a Technical with an unusual ingredient, and a Showstopper that the heat in the tent must not destroy. Eh, good luck guys. 

Revolting Ireland (Virgin Media One, 10pm) 

The documentary series about protesting in Ireland continues. We’re into the 1970s now, featuring hunger strikes and the fight for gay rights. Simon Delaney hosts.

Everyone’s talking about… Graham Norton’s most dramatic guest 

PastedImage-19252 BBC BBC

Graham Norton has interviewed more celebs than almost anyone else. So what pissed him off in terms of divaness? Graham told The Daily Telegraph that the mystery guest was quite demanding. 

We had someone once who required nine dressing rooms. But we managed it, and then in the afternoon someone from their team came running into the production office saying, ‘It’s a 911 situation. We need another dressing room.’

But why?

Well, they needed to charge their mobile. Guesses as to who it was, please.
